Descent into Despair: Analyzing the Depths of 'Deux' by the GazettE

The song 'Deux' by the GazettE delves into themes of despair, inner conflict, and the struggle against overwhelming darkness.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a person standing at the edge of hopelessness, grappling with their inner demons and the harsh realities of life. The repeated references to 'インフェルノ' (Inferno) and 'nightmare' suggest a hellish, nightmarish state of mind where the protagonist feels trapped and tormented.

The phrase 'You're my enemy' indicates a deep-seated internal conflict, possibly between the protagonist's desires and their harsh reality. The 'Scary night' and 'Split mind' further emphasize the mental anguish and the duality of their existence. The lyrics also touch upon themes of isolation and brokenness, as seen in lines like 'こころがこわれてしまった' (my heart is broken) and 'かもくとねむれこわれたまま' (sleep silently, still broken). This suggests a profound sense of loneliness and a struggle to find peace within oneself.

The song also explores the idea of surrendering to despair, as indicated by the lines 'さあとびおりたさきの「おわり」にみとれ' (be captivated by the 'end' you jumped into) and 'We will die.' This fatalistic outlook is a stark reminder of the protagonist's resignation to their fate. However, there is a glimmer of hope in the line 'きみはぼくのゆめとなる' (you will become my dream), suggesting that even in the depths of despair, there is a longing for connection and a dream of something better.
